Anoctamin pharmacology

open access: yes
: TMEM16 proteins, also known as anoctamins, are a family of ten membrane proteins with various tissue expression and subcellular localization. TMEM16A (anoctamin 1) is a plasma membrane protein that acts as a calcium-activated chloride channel.

The anoctamin family: TMEM16A and TMEM16B as calcium-activated chloride channels

open access: yes, 2011
The Ca(2+)-activated Cl(-) channels (CaCCs) are involved in a variety of physiological functions, such as transepithelial anion transport, smooth muscle contraction and olfaction.
